"I found this DVD at Kmart for $3. It comes with a cd of Christmas music. I figured for the price I would take a chance.
It was a made for TV movie from 1986 based on the novelette "London Snow". It stars Katherine Helmond, veteran actor Sid Caesar, a very young Melissa Joan Hart, and Kimble Joyner. It won an Emmy in 1987 for cinematography and an ASC award in 1988. It's a nice family movie, but it's only 48 minutes long.
The movie seems to be set in the 1950's. Mrs Mutterance (Helmond)is a widow who runs a candy shop in the lower level of a building where she lives on the 2nd floor with her 2 adopted children (Joyner and Hart). Her mean spirited Landlord, Mr Snyder(Caesar)tells her she has two weeks to vacate the building 2 days before Christmas. After a blizzard, Mr. Snyder turns up missing. Will Mrs. Mutterance be able to find him?
Melissa Joan Hart is very cute in this movie. I thought all of the actors were good, but I thought this presentation fell short of a holiday classic. I think it is a better production than the made for tv movies are today. Well worth the $3 I paid for it."
